Comment (by larryv@…):

 Replying to [comment:3 ryandesign@…]:
 > Changed this in r102780. I am not certain about the other changes. What
 were the warnings you received?

 From eyeballing it, it looks like the warnings are either:
 - `printf`-style format specifiers that don’t quite match the arguments
 given. These should be fine to commit; plus, they’re just for logging.
 - Redundant invocations of `[NSString +stringWithString]` with an NSString
 literal argument. Those might once have been necessary for memory
 management.
